实施HTTPS的最佳实践
HTTPS是一种安全协议,用于在互联网上传输数据时保护数据的安全性。以下是实施HTTPS的最佳实践,以确保您的数据在传输过程中得到保护。
1. 启用HTTPS
启用HTTPS的最简单方法是使用支持HTTPS的Web服务器,如Apache或gix。在服务器上配置HTTPS,需要获取有效的SSL/TLS证书,并将其安装在服务器上。
2. 配置安全协议
使用安全协议,如TLS 1.2或更高版本,以确保您的数据传输得到加密和安全保护。禁用不安全的协议,如SSLv3和TLS 1.1。
3. 使用最新版本的HTTPS
使用最新版本的HTTPS协议,以确保您的数据传输得到最佳的保护。旧版本的HTTPS可能存在安全漏洞,因此应该尽量避免使用。
4. 强制使用HTTPS
强制使用HTTPS可以确保您的网站用户在访问您的网站时始终使用安全的连接。您可以通过在Web服务器上配置重定向来实现这一点,将所有HTTP请求重定向到HTTPS。
5. 启用HSTS策略
HSTS(HTTP严格传输安全)是一种安全策略,可帮助您防止中间人攻击。启用HSTS策略,将HTTP请求重定向到HTTPS,并使用HSTS头部告诉浏览器在以后访问时始终使用HTTPS。
6. 保护敏感数据
对于敏感数据,如信用卡信息、个人身份信息等,应该使用HTTPS来保护传输。这将确保敏感数据在传输过程中不会被截获或篡改。
7. 验证证书链
在启用HTTPS之前,应该验证您的SSL/TLS证书链是否有效和完整。如果证书链无效或缺失,浏览器将显示安全警告,并可能阻止用户访问您的网站。
8. 使用可信任的证书颁发机构
使用可信任的证书颁发机构(CA)颁发的SSL/TLS证书,以确保您的证书受到广泛的支持和信任。一些知名的CA包括Symaec、DigiCer和Comodo等。